Casares, one of the most scenic and photographed white-mountain villages in Andalucia, is ideally located to offer something for everyone, the Casares coast offers peaceful beaches and spectacular scenery. Lying fourteen kilometres inland, Casares is perched high on a hilltop, its’ whitewashed houses cascade down beneath the remains of a splendid Moorish castle. This is the real Spain; a working village with rich cultural heritage, unspoilt by tourism but central enough to provide an excellent base from which to explore.
The village is surrounded by the stunning natural parks of the Sierra Bermeja and Sierra Crestellina, with dramatic views at every turn. Whilst the rugged mountains and rolling hills provide natural challenges for hikers, birdwatchers and horse riders, competitive sporting fans can enjoy world class golf courses and polo, as well as fishing, sailing and surfing, all within easy reach.
To the south-west, the region of Casares stretches towards the wine-making town of Manilva, and the Roman Baths de la Hedionda. Healing mineral waters and mud baths prove a great draw for adults and children alike! The landscape opens up to panoramic views of Gibraltar to the south, across the Rio Genal valley and the neighbouring white villages of Gaucin and Jimena de la Frontera, both of which boast a unique atmosphere of their own.
